Why I Consider Direct/Reflecting Technology

I like the idea behind Bose Direct Reflecting Speakers because they are designed to send sound both directly at me and off the walls around me. In my experience, that can make music feel more spacious and immersive. If I want sound that fills the room instead of just coming from one point, this is one of the main reasons I consider Bose.

Room Placement Matters to Me

I’ve found that placement makes a big difference with reflective speakers. I usually look for a setup that gives the speakers enough space to work properly, since walls and room layout affect the sound. Before buying, I think about where I can place them for the best results, not just where they look good.
